Description
Cilantro lime rice is a vibrant and flavorful dish made with fluffy long-grain white rice, lime juice, and fresh cilantro, perfect as a side for Mexican and Latin American meals.
Ingredients
- Long-grain white rice: 1 cup (about 200 grams)
- Water: 2 cups (about 480 milliliters)
- Fresh cilantro: 1/2 cup, finely chopped (about 15 grams)
- Lime juice: 2 tablespoons (about 30 milliliters)
- Lime zest: 1 teaspoon (about 5 grams)
- Garlic: 2 cloves, minced
- Olive oil: 1 tablespoon (about 15 milliliters)
- Salt: 1/2 teaspoon (about 3 grams)
- Black pepper: 1/4 teaspoon (about 1 gram)
Instructions
- Rinse the rice under cold running water until the water runs clear.
- In a medium saucepan, combine the rinsed rice with 2 cups of water and 1/2 teaspoon of salt.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low, cover, and simmer for 15-20 minutes.
- In a small skillet, he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té for 1-2 minutes until fragrant.
- After the rice has finished cooking, let it sit covered for 5 minutes. Fluff the rice with a fork.
- In a large mixing bowl, combine the fluffed rice with the sautéed garlic and olive oil mixture, chopped cilantro, lime juice, and lime zest. Stir gently to mix.
Notes
- For a stronger lime flavor, add more lime juice or zest.
- Consider adding diced vegetables like bell peppers or corn for added nutrition.
- For a spicy version, incorporate diced jalapeños or red pepper flakes.
Nutrition
- Serving Size: 1 cup
- Calories: 200
- Sugar: 0g
- Sodium: 150mg
- Fat: 5g
- Saturated Fat: 0.5g
- Unsaturated Fat: 4.5g
- Trans Fat: 0g
- Carbohydrates: 36g
- Fiber: 1g
- Protein: 4g
- Cholesterol: 0mg
